Transaction d37872c973cf32cfd6dbdf4f29a6517fff61806e4db0daa4eaae16e2b3897145
1 Input
1 Output
-
d37872c973cf32cfd6dbdf4f29a6517fff61806e4db0daa4eaae16e2b3897145:0
- value
- 25481687
- script pubkey
- OP_0 OP_PUSHBYTES_20 e0a5a7ff3b7263ddab96508506905267941d86ea
- address
- bc1quzj60lemwf3am2uk2zzsdyzjv72pmph2mwr3fg